Composition and Characteristics


Thick poly cotton fabric typically consists of a blend that can range from 65% polyester and 35% cotton to various other ratios. This combination takes advantage of the best qualities of both fibers. Polyester, known for its strength and resistance to wrinkles and shrinking, complements cotton, which offers breathability, softness, and comfort. The resulting fabric exhibits a robust nature, making it well-suited for heavy-duty applications.


One of the most remarkable characteristics of thick poly cotton fabric is its durability. Unlike pure cotton, which can wear down more quickly, the polyester fibers provide added strength. This durability makes it ideal for items that experience regular wear and tear, such as work uniforms, bags, and upholstery.


Comfort and Versatility


In addition to its resilience, thick poly cotton fabric is incredibly comfortable. While it retains the breathable qualities of cotton, the polyester infusion enhances moisture-wicking properties, allowing for a more pleasant wearing experience, especially in humid conditions. This characteristic has made it a popular choice for clothing, from casual wear to work attire.

The versatility of thick poly cotton fabric is another compelling reason for its widespread use. It can be easily dyed in a variety of colors and patterns, allowing for creative expression in apparel design and home décor. Whether it's vibrant prints for summer dresses or neutral tones for upholstery, the possibilities are nearly limitless.


Easy Maintenance


Another standout feature of thick poly cotton fabric is its low maintenance requirements. The blend is typically machine washable and resistant to stains and fading, which means items made from this fabric can withstand the rigors of everyday life while maintaining their aesthetic appeal. This ease of care is particularly attractive for busy households and individuals who desire both style and functionality.


Eco-Friendly Considerations


As consumers grow increasingly eco-conscious, it’s worth noting that thick poly cotton fabric can also be a more sustainable option compared to pure synthetic fabrics. While polyester is derived from petrochemicals, the cotton component provides a biobased alternative. Moreover, some manufacturers are focusing on recycling and sustainable production methods, which contribute to reducing their environmental footprint.
